Balance Exercises For Those Recovering From Cancer Treatments

Balance exercises are an excellent first step to initiating a fitness program for those recovering from Cancer treatments. Recently, the Journal of National Cancer Institute reported on recent research that concluded, " Few other leads have shown as much promise as physical activity in extending the lives of cancer survivors." An excellent example of the benefits of exercise have recently been demonstrated by Iram Leon. Mr Leon was diagnosed with an inoperable, cancerous brain tumor. A short time ago, Mr Leon had to quit his job because of his declining cognitive skills. The cancer, however, has not stopped his running. Iram Leon won the Gusher Marathon in 3:07:35. Even more amazing, he was pushing his daughter in the stroller during the marathon. Mr Leon exemplifies the new theme of the American Cancer Society and other medical groups who now recommend physical activity for their patients. The idea is to start where you are. Begin with standing balance exercises to develop good stability and safety. Progress to walking equilibrium exercises, to promote steadiness with walking on various terrain. Next, add in light weight lifting routines and a walking program that boosts both mood, mental status, cardiovascular efficiency, leg strength and a host of other benefits.
